In 1609 a relative of my husbands died as a young woman. She was Cecilia Bulstrode and was a gentlewoman of the Queen's bedchamber. Ben Jonson wrote an 'Epitaph on Cecilia Bulstrode'. He had previously lampooned her as the 'Court Pucelle'. Does anyone know where I can find copies of each of these works? I'd be grateful for your help.
